L Shape Bunks For Small Spaces

If you have a small space but enjoy sleepovers with the family, then consider an L-shaped bunk. This kind of bunk bed comes with two twin beds that look like an L from above.

This design can be stacked to free up the space in your bedroom, and provides plenty of storage. It's also extremely versatile and can be utilized for a variety of reasons.

Space-Saving Solution

Unlike traditional bunk beds that stack sleeping platforms vertically or perpendicular to each other, l shape bunks use an angled design, which provides more floor space for play and storage. They also create a clean silhouette that is perfect for vacation homes, kids or spare bedrooms.

Safety

Apart from the space-saving benefits that l shape bunks offer they also have safety features that ensure your children have a secure and comfortable sleeping environment. Guardrails and a sturdy staircase or ladder are available to protect your children from injuries while sleeping or playing. Some models also have distinctive features like a slide that will engage kids' imaginations during playtime and bedtime. However, it's crucial to consider the age of your kids when choosing the size and the height of bunk beds for them. It is recommended that children of younger ages be placed in beds that are lower while older children can use the top bunks. To avoid accidents or structural damage, it is important to think about the capacity of each bunk.
